SALEM, Ore. – Freshman
Matt Jones tied the NCU record in the 100m on Saturday, highlighting the Beacons performance at the Willamette Invitational.
Â
Jones took 12th place with a time of 11.16, equaling a mark set by teammate
Antonio Campos-Perez last year.
Â
A handful of season-bests were also achieved on Saturday. Campos-Perez ran a 22.66 in the 200m,
Micah Jury ran a 56.91 in the 400m Hurdles and the 4x100m relay team of Joshua Chesnut, Campos-Perez, Jones, and
Michael Andrews posted a 43.43. Also,
Alec Duncan topped his own season best with a 53.93 in the 400m.
Â
Having hit a provisional qualification earlier this season,
Christian Hackney cemented his place on the NAIA roster in the Javelin with an "A" standard qualifying heave of 58.15m. He was the top collegiate finisher and his throw was the best in the Cascade Conference so far this season.
